시에 나타난 어학적 요소 분석 -윤동주 시의 서술어 표현 양상을 중심으로-
장동환 ( Dong Hwan Jung ) 한말연구학회 2012 한말연구 Vol.- No.30
Linguistics which is bent on establishing strict scientific logic to everyday language as its main subject was prone to be inactive in study of literature. Interpretation in the dimension of art was considered as a realm of literature. However if linguistics should open itself to diverse and characteristic aspect and function of language then literature is truly one of the most important source for uncovering poetic function, aesthetic aspect and process for creation of beauty of language. Recently level of linguistic interest in works of Korean literature has been heightened. Thus value and importance of language in literary works have been recognized and people concerned are contemplating profoundly about what can be done by Korean language for literature works and linguistic analysis of poems and novels have been carried out. Poet Yun Dong-Ju among many other Korean poets of middle standing while enduring and internalizing time he had took the path of self verification process thoroughly. Literary language which was used in the process of Poet Yun Dong-Ju`s watching, enduring and aesthetizing is considered as very valuable in searching for poetic function, aesthetic function and creating of meaning. Thus this author attempted to broaden horizon of literary language through analysis of the Poet Yun Dong-Ju`s poems and to disclose identity and secret of literary language clearly and precisely through this study. Literary language being used in the process of Poet Yun Dong-Ju`s watching, enduring and aesthetizing is viewed as very valuable for search of its poetic and aesthetic function and creating of meaning. Furthermore Poet Yun Dong-Ju contributed to extending horizon of literary language by expressing predicates in diverse aspects.

When large scales DG are connected to the distribution system of unidirectional power currents, bi-directional power currents are formed, making it impossible to use conventional overcurrent protection methods alone to detect and isolate fault sections for ground and short-circuit faults. To solve these problems, this study proposed the method of protection against single-line-ground fault of common neutral line multi-contact local power distribution system using distance relay and directional relay. The proposed protection method was applied to the common neutral multi-ground distribution system to validate the protection against single-line-ground fault through the PSCAD/EMTDC software package and efectively detect and isolate only the zone of single-line-ground fault without malfunctions.
남자 초·중학생의 무산소성 작업능력과 무산소성 파워의 관계

The critical power(CP) is the highest intensity to sustain for a long time without a fatigue. The anaerobic work capacity(AWC) is the highest anaerobic capacity to be provided by anaerobic energy system without the infection of hypoxia. The purpose of this study was to determine the relationship between AWC and AnP and to verify the validity of AWC. The subjects were consisted of 10 elementary and 10 middle school male students(12.8±1.3yrs, 159.3±12.1㎝, 49.4±11.8㎏). The critical power and anaerobic work capacity were calculated by work-time relationship after four cycle ergometry test to fatigue from 1 to 10 minute. The anaerobic power included Margaria-Kalmen test, Sargent jump and Wingate test. The main finding were as follows. The AWC of elementary and middle school students. were 6.47±2.63KJ and 11.10±3.01KJ. The AWC of elementary students was 58.3% of the middle school students's one. The AnP of elementary students were 47.2∼66.5% of the middle school students's one. And there were high correlation between AWC and AnP(0.64∼0.87, P<0.01). This study showed that AWC is useful index on AnP both elementary and middle school students.
